Air defenses shot down a Russian missile near Kryvyi Rih

Today, May 12, air defense forces shot down an enemy rocket in the Kryvyi Rih district of the Dnipropetrovsk region.

Yevhen Sytnychenko, the head of Kryvyi Rih RVA, announced this in Telegram.

«One enemy missile was destroyed by the forces of our Air Defense Forces in the Kryvyi Rih District,» the message reads.

We will remind, during the past day, on May 11, the air defense of southern Ukraine destroyed 5 Russian reconnaissance UAVs.

In addition, on the night of May 11, the Russian occupiers attacked Tiahynka of the Beryslav district of the Kherson region. One of the launched KABs hit in a private house.

Also, on the night of May 9, the building of the former cultural center in the village of Pervomaiske was partially destroyed due to an unmanned aerial vehicle hit.
